Mar 26, 2021 What is qBitTorrent for Mac The qBittorrent project was started in March 2006 to create a lightweight but featureful BitTorrent client that would be multi-platform and very easy to use. Ubuntu packages
qBittorrent is now available in official Ubuntu repositories since v9.04 'Jaunty'.
More up-to-date packages are published on our stable and unstable PPAs.
The stable PPA supports Ubuntu 16.04 LTS (only the libtorrent-rasterbar package), 18.04 LTS, 18.10, 19.10 and 20.04 LTS.
The unstable PPA supports Ubuntu 16.04 LTS, 18.04 LTS, 19.04, 19.10 and 20.04 LTS.
Quick instructions
To use these PPAs please use the following command and make sure your version is supported:
sudo add-apt-repository ppa:qbittorrent-team/qbittorrent-stable
# or qBittorrent Unstable
sudo add-apt-repository ppa:qbittorrent-team/qbittorrent-unstable
Then install qBittorrent by doing this:

qBittorrent is a peer to peer Bittorrent client that has been developed using the Qt4 toolkit and the libtorrent-rasterbar. The project is maintained by volunteers, and is available on multiple platforms, such as macOS, Windows, Linux, FreeBSD, or OS/2.
User friendly Bittorrent client that integrates searching capabilities
Finding you way around the qBittorrent application proves to be fairly intuitive: the main window is separated in two tabs, one for monitoring transfers, and one for finding new torrents. qBittorrent will perform searches on multiple BitTorrent sites at the same time, and even allows you to restrict the results to a specific category.
For each torrent in the results list, qBittorrent allows you to see the archive size, the source search engine, and the number of leechers and seeders. In addition, you can choose to open the torrent description page in your default web browser.
Integrates basic download management capabilities
To help you get started, qBittorrent allows you to send a specific torrent to the download list with a simple mouse click. Of course, you can also manually open torrent files, or add them to the list with a simple drag and drop.
qBittorrent includes support for most of the operations one should expect to perform when dealing with torrents: content selection, queueing, prioritizing, and so on. In addition, you can also use qBittorrent to make your own torrents and share them with others.
Naturally, via the app’s Preferences, you get to adjust both the download and the upload limits, you can change the default download location, the maximum number of allowed connections, you get to direct the traffic through a proxy server, and much more.
